Update

All parts have been installed. The DME, S/C Pulley and Belt have just reached, hopefully by today they will be sent to the workshop so we can run this thing!

Update

The boys started to work on the radiator, OEM heat exchanger kit. Cleaned most of the engine bay and parts, lots of leaks here-and-there but fixed 90 percent of the problems. The last remaining part is left, the ABC Steering Pump hose, it was slightly damaged so I decided to get a new one before any problems happen.
